Rodin’s Head of Pierre de Wissant fetched HK$ 64,900,000 at Tiancheng International Auctioneer Ltd.

HONG KONG.- Tiancheng International Auctioneer Limited held its inaugural auction in Hong Kong. The star lot of the sale, Monumental Head of Pierre de Wissant by Auguste Rodin, fetched HK$ 64,900,000 (US$8,327,254). The bronze head sculpture in colossal form was sold to an Asian private collector over the phone after intense bidding, the sold price is over three times of the pre-sale low estimate of 20 million Hong Kong dollars. “We are happy with the sale result today,” said Ingrid Lam, CEO of Tiancheng International. “It is our honour to present this museum quality Western work of art to Asian collectors at our inaugural auction.
